Department of Culture, Heritage and the Gaeltacht

Official Languages Act 2003 Compliance

566. To ask the Minister for Culture, Heritage and the Gaeltacht the number of State bodies that have not to date submitted a language plan under the Official Languages Act 2003; the name of each such organisation in tabular form;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[41219/18]

In accordance with Section 11(1) of the Official Languages Act (2003), my Department is actively engaged in the process of agreeing inaugural and subsequent schemes with a large number of public bodies. At present there are 43 public bodies who are in the process of preparing their inaugural language schemes.

Having regard to the reduction in the number of public sector bodies since the commencement of the Act, the drafting of a new Regulation to update the list of public bodies listed in the First Schedule to the Act is currently being progressed as a priority by my Department.

It should be noted that the language schemes currently being implemented cover the majority of public bodies who have regular contact with the general public.

Inaugural draft schemes to be confirmed under section 11 (1) of the 2003 Act

1. Abbey Theatre

2. Adoption Authority of Ireland

3. Bord Gáis Éireann

4. Bord Iascaigh Mhara

5. Bord na Móna

6. Cavan & Monaghan Education & Training Board

7. Charities Regulatory Authority

8. Child and Family Support Agency

9. City of Dublin Education & Training Board

10. Coillte Teoranta

11. Commission for Energy Regulation

12. Competition and Consumer Protection Authority

13. Córas Iompair Éireann Group incorporating Bus Éireann, Bus Átha Cliath & Iarnród Éireann

14. Cork Airport Authority plc

15. Cork Institute of Technology

16. Employment Appeals Tribunal

17. Enterprise Ireland

18. Fáilte Ireland - National Tourism Development Authority

19. Food Safety Authority of Ireland

20. Government Information Services

21. Health and Safety Authority

22. Heritage Council

23. Housing Agency

24. IDA Ireland

25. Inland Fisheries Ireland

26. Irish Blood Transfusion Service

27. Irish Prison Service

28. Irish Sports Council

29. Kilkenny and Carlow Education and Training Board

30. Limerick and Clare Education and Training Board

31. Limerick Institute of Technology

32. Longford & Westmeath Education and Training Board

33. National Archives

34. National Concert Hall

35. National Disability Authority

36. National Library of Ireland

37. National Milk Agency

38. Office of the Appeals Commissioners

39. Office of the Chief Medical Officer for the Civil Service

40. Probation Service

41. The Health Service Executive

42. The Private Security Authority

43. The Sustainable Energy Authority of Ireland
